What contract structure fits a automotive load in the PJM market?

It depends on how much PJM price risk your automotive operation can absorb. A steady business hours concentration with some 24/7 operations load often favors a longer fixed term for budget certainty; a more variable one leaves room for an indexed component. We model both against your 80,000-300,000 kWh/month before recommending one.

When should a Georgetown, DE automotive business start the rate analysis process?

Earlier than most do. Starting 6 to 12 months before your contract expires lets us time your rate analysis to favorable PJM conditions rather than negotiating under deadline pressure — which is when automotive buyers overpay.
